San Basso and Diffusioni Festivals impose new safety bans in Italy

In Termoli, the Port Authority issued ordinances for the San Basso celebrations on August 3‑5, restricting vehicle access, pedestrian movement and maritime activities around the Marina di San Pietro. The area within 100 m of the fireworks launch site is closed to traffic, and a 300 m radius at sea is barred to navigation, anchoring, swimming and fishing during specified time windows. Vehicles left in the prohibited zone will be removed.

In Grottammare, Mayor Alessandro Rocchi signed a new ordinance on August 3 that lifts the ban on glass bottles and cans for that evening only, after the first night of the Diffusioni Festival was cancelled. The restrictions on glass and metal containers remain in force for the evenings of August 4‑6, requiring drinks to be served in paper or plastic cups and prohibiting public consumption of beverages in glass or cans outside authorized venues.
